What does an associate professor of computer science do?

An Associate Professor of Computer Science is a mid-level faculty member at a college or university who teaches undergraduate and graduate courses, conducts research in computer science, and publishes scholarly work. They also supervise students, mentor junior faculty, and may participate in curriculum development and academic committees. In addition to teaching and research, Associate Professors often contribute to their academic community through service, such as organizing conferences or reviewing papers. Promotion to this rank usually follows demonstrated excellence in teaching, research, and service over several years as an Assistant Professor.

What is the difference between Associate Professor Computer Science vs Assistant Professor Computer Science?

The main difference between Associate Professor Computer Science and Assistant Professor Computer Science lies in experience and rank. Associate Professors have more research, teaching, and service experience, often holding a higher academic rank with additional responsibilities. Assistant Professors are typically early-career faculty members working towards promotion. Both roles require a Ph.D. and are common in university settings, but the Associate Professor position signifies a more advanced career stage.

Assistant / Associate Professor of Surgery – VITAL Lab (AI & Aortic Surgery Research)

Work Arrangement: Location: Houston, TX. Salary Range: FLSA Status: Exempt.

Overview

Baylor College of Medicine is seeking an exceptional PhD-level AI researcher to serve as a founding leader of the Vascular Intelligence for Translational AI & Learning (VITAL) Lab – a newly funded $14M initiative focused on transforming aortic surgery through advanced artificial intelligence, data science, and translational research.

This individual will be responsible for building the VITAL Lab from inception, establishing a state‑of‑the‑art research infrastructure, and leading the development of innovative AI‑enabled solutions to improve diagnosis, procedural planning, and outcomes in aortic disease.

The ideal candidate will combine deep technical expertise in AI delivery (computer vision, machine learning, multimodal data) with demonstrated experience in clinical research—preferably in cardiovascular, aortic surgery domains.

Job Duties
  • Lead the end‑to‑end buildout of the VITAL Lab, including infrastructure, governance, and research roadmap.
  • Develop a world‑class AI research ecosystem aligned with Baylor Medicine's strategic priorities in vascular and aortic care.
  • Oversee utilization of a $14M grant portfolio, ensuring execution against milestones, deliverables, and reporting requirements.
  • Establish partnerships across surgery, radiology, cardiology, and computational sciences.
  • Design and deploy scalable AI pipelines for imaging, clinical, and genomic data.
  • Lead development of a large‑scale, high‑quality aortic research database (imaging repository, clinical registry, biobank integration).
  • Implement machine learning, deep learning, and computer vision models for:
    • Aortic disease detection and classification.
    • Surgical planning and simulation, including digital twin creation and computational fluid dynamic analysis.
    • Outcomes prediction and risk stratification.
  • Drive AI model deployment and real‑world clinical integration.
  • Lead high‑impact peer‑reviewed publications in top‑tier journals.
  • Develop and submit extramural grant proposals (NIH, NSF, DoD, industry partnerships).
  • Present research at national and international conferences.
  • Establish the VITAL Lab as a global leader in AI‑driven aortic surgery research.
  • Collaborate closely with vascular and aortic surgeons to translate clinical needs into AI solutions.
  • Integrate AI tools into clinical workflows and surgical decision‑making.
  • Support the development of next‑generation clinical trials leveraging AI insights.
  • Mentor trainees including PhD students, residents, fellows, and research staff.
  • Develop educational programming in AI for surgery and translational data science.
Minimum Qualifications
  • PhD in Computer Science, Biomedical Engineering, Data Science, or related field.
  • Demonstrated expertise in machine learning, deep learning, and AI system development.
  • Proven track record of peer‑reviewed publications and research impact.
  • Experience building or contributing to large‑scale research datasets or platforms.
Preferred Qualifications
  • Prior experience in cardiovascular disease research.
  • Experience working in academic medical centers or translational research environments.
  • Demonstrated success in AI deployment.
  • Experience managing large research programs, labs, or grant‑funded initiatives.
  • Proficiency in medical imaging analysis (CT, MRI, 3D reconstruction).
  • Familiarity with regulatory frameworks (HIPAA, data governance, IRB).
